Report exports in the Quillbase API default to UTC regardless of the requesting user's profile timezone. To localize timestamps, pass the tz query parameter with an IANA zone name; invalid zones return a 422. Note that scheduled exports resolve the timezone at generation time, not at schedule creation, so daylight-saving shifts can move row boundaries. Never mix tz with the deprecated offset_minutes parameter. All export endpoints require authentication; include the following token in the Authorization header.

session JWT of yawep-yawep = eyJhbGciOiJIUzI1NiIsInR5cCI6IkpXVCJ9.eyJzdWIiOiI3pWF3_In0.aXYsHiog

### Account Recovery — Quenchley Retention Sweeper

When a customer is locked out of the Quenchley sweeper dashboard, first pause any active retention sweeps for their tenant; recovery while a sweep runs can orphan deletion markers. Verify the tenant's sweep schedule is suspended, then start recovery from the support console. Once identity checks pass, the console requests the recovery passphrase, which appears on the line below.

recovery phrase for bawep-kawef: oliath-casdor

**Q: How does the cleaning crew get in after hours?** Contractors from Brightmop Services arrive weeknights after 19:00 at the Halverton Building's east entrance. They sign in with the duty guard and collect a temporary pass from the lockbox. If the guard is on rounds, the lockbox can be opened with the code below.

badge for fadup-kaguf: bdg-KBHUFA-43685103

Quillcheck enforces SQL linting on every file under /migrations before a release candidate is cut. Rules cover forbidden DDL in hotfix branches, mandatory idempotent guards, and naming conventions for indexes. Violations block the pipeline; warnings do not. Rule sets are versioned and pinned per release train, so bumping the linter requires an explicit override in the release manifest. The lint API runs as an internal service and all CI calls must authenticate. Use the key below when triggering manual lint runs.

gateway credential: kto3_qfe